Course Details
• Advanced Sports Journalism: This unit will cover the latest trends and techniques in sports journalism, focusing on in-depth reporting, interviewing skills, and ethical considerations.
• Sports Media Production: Students will learn about the production process of sports media content, including video and audio editing, lighting, sound design, and post-production techniques.
• Digital Sports Marketing: This unit will teach students how to leverage digital platforms to promote sports events and teams, with a focus on social media, email marketing, and content marketing strategies.
• Data Journalism in Sports: Students will learn how to analyze and interpret sports data to create compelling narratives and visualizations, using tools like Excel, Tableau, and R.
• Sports Broadcasting: This unit will cover the fundamentals of sports broadcasting, including play-by-play commentary, color commentary, and sideline reporting.
• Sports Photography: Students will learn how to capture high-quality sports photos, including action shots, portraits, and team photos.
• Sports Public Relations: This unit will teach students how to manage the public image of sports teams and athletes, including media relations, crisis communication, and community engagement.
• Advanced Sports Content Strategy: This unit will cover the latest trends in sports content strategy, including audience segmentation, content planning, and distribution strategies.
• Sports Analytics: Students will learn how to use data and analytics to inform sports coverage and decision-making, including performance analysis, predictive modeling, and statistical analysis.
